Blue Mountain, MS- William Carey University opened their 2008-09 season in style as they routed the Toppers of Blue Mountain College on Saturday night, 103-72.
Both teams traded baskets in the games opening eight minutes until pre-season All-GCAC selection Dexter Middleton's thunderous slam dunk sparked a 19-3 Crusader run which helped propel Carey to a 60-37 lead. The Crusaders used a suffocating full court press to force seventeen first half turnovers which led to Carey shooting a blistering 65.7% (25-38) in the half.
The Toppers cut the Carey lead to a 60-46 at the start of the second but the Crusaders regrouped to run away with 103-72 victory.
Middleton led the Crusaders with a game high 25 points. Paul Lubin added 12 points and 11 rebounds. Terry Wade finished with 11 points while Johnny Lockhart and Johnathan Woodland each chipped in with 10 points.
The Crusaders return to action at home on Tuesday as the take on Lambuth University.
Tip-off is set for 7:00 pm at Clinton Gym.
